A FIRST HALF haul of 11 points from out half Brian Keegan gave Presentation, Glasthule, a hard fought victory over Wilson's Hospital at Westmanstown.

Keegan signalled his intentions from the start with a determined run that brought his team close to the Wilsons line. From the resulting scrum, he collected Eoin Smith's pass to cross In the right corner.

Although he missed the conversion, an accurate penalty just five minutes later suggested a one sided affair. However, the Wilson's pack rallied and, undeterred by an obvious disadvantage inside were unlucky not to score after a series of penalties close to Glasthule's line.

Keegan added another penalty before half time.
